Your watering is fine. Plain coco needs multiple daily feedings. I have had good luck with GnatNix. It goes on the top of the medium about an inch thick. It prevents the adult gnats from getting into the coco to lay eggs.

……sprays and poisons will work, but if I can keep from using them I do.......success with most pest means understanding their life cycle's.....…...gnats need calm air or they can not fly around.....the smallest breeze keeps them from moving around well.....if they cant fly around they cant hook up and breed......I keep fans running all the time.....even with lights off...…..and never have gnats..... the lower drain holes in the pots also have pieces of scotch brite covering them.....lets water drain feely, but blocks critters.....
